Output 73d066da3ed28e31d18241eff9e038a47969fa0e5f8edfdbf1d39ffbc0efeb80:1

value
3305466
script pubkey
OP_0 OP_PUSHBYTES_20 ed8186eae8966d94823afdc1a4ecc87605fa8128
address
bc1qakqcd6hgjekefq36lhq6fmxgwczl4qfg4yd2fa
transaction
73d066da3ed28e31d18241eff9e038a47969fa0e5f8edfdbf1d39ffbc0efeb80
spent
true